电子类产品技术文档管理,如何提供多语言PDF下载?
本文目录导读:
在全球化的商业环境中,电子类产品的制造商和供应商需要向不同国家和地区的客户提供技术文档,为了确保用户能够准确理解产品的使用、维护和安全信息,多语言技术文档的提供变得至关重要,PDF格式因其跨平台兼容性、易于分发和打印的特性,成为技术文档管理的首选格式之一,本文将探讨如何在电子类产品技术文档管理中高效提供多语言PDF下载,涵盖文档创建、翻译管理、版本控制及分发策略等方面。
多语言技术文档的重要性
1 全球化市场需求
随着电子类产品销往全球市场,不同地区的用户需要以母语阅读产品说明书、安装指南、安全手册等技术文档,多语言支持不仅能提升用户体验,还能降低因语言障碍导致的操作错误和安全风险。
2 法规合规要求
许多国家和地区对技术文档的语言有明确的法律要求,欧盟的《机械指令》(Machinery Directive)规定,技术文档必须提供成员国官方语言版本,企业必须确保文档符合目标市场的语言法规。
3 品牌形象与客户满意度
提供专业的多语言技术文档可以增强品牌信誉,提高客户满意度,清晰的文档能减少售后支持成本,并降低因误解导致的产品退货或投诉。
技术文档管理的核心挑战
1 翻译质量与一致性
技术文档的翻译必须准确无误,尤其是涉及安全警告和操作步骤的部分,术语和风格需保持一致,避免不同语言版本之间的歧义。
2 版本控制与更新
电子类产品的技术文档可能频繁更新(如固件升级、新功能发布),多语言版本的管理需确保所有语言同步更新,避免信息不一致。
3 格式兼容性与可访问性
PDF文档需在不同设备和操作系统上保持格式稳定,并符合可访问性标准(如支持屏幕阅读器),以满足残障用户的需求。
4 高效分发与下载管理
企业需提供便捷的下载方式,确保用户能快速获取所需语言版本的文档,同时管理服务器带宽和存储成本。
如何高效提供多语言PDF下载?
1 结构化文档编写
采用结构化写作工具(如DITA、Markdown)可提高文档的可复用性,便于多语言翻译和管理,结构化内容允许模块化翻译,减少重复劳动。
推荐工具:
- DITA (Darwin Information Typing Architecture):适用于大型技术文档项目,支持内容复用和条件化发布。
- MadCap Flare:提供多语言支持,可生成多种格式(包括PDF)。
- Markdown + Pandoc:轻量级方案,适合小型团队。
2 专业翻译与本地化
2.1 机器翻译+人工校对
- 使用DeepL、Google Translate等AI翻译工具进行初稿翻译,再由专业译员校对,提高效率并降低成本。
- 确保技术术语的一致性,可使用术语库(如SDL MultiTerm)和翻译记忆库(Trados)。
2.2 本地化调整
- 除语言翻译外,还需调整日期格式、计量单位、文化相关示例等,确保文档符合目标市场的习惯。
3 自动化PDF生成
使用自动化工具(如LaTeX、PrinceXML、Adobe FrameMaker)批量生成多语言PDF,避免手动调整格式。
推荐方案:
- LaTeX:适用于高精度排版,支持多语言(通过
babel
或polyglossia
包)。 - Pandoc:可将Markdown转换为PDF,结合模板实现多语言输出。
- Adobe FrameMaker:支持结构化写作和自动化发布。
4 版本控制与内容管理
采用版本控制系统(如Git)或专业内容管理系统(CMS)管理多语言文档,确保所有语言版本同步更新。
推荐工具:
- Git + GitHub/GitLab:适用于技术团队,支持协作和版本追踪。
- Contentful/Sitecore:企业级CMS,支持多语言内容管理。
5 多语言PDF下载方案
5.1 按语言分类存储
在网站或文档管理系统中按语言分类存储PDF文件,
/docs/
├── en/
│ └── user_manual.pdf
├── zh/
│ └── user_manual.pdf
└── fr/
└── user_manual.pdf
5.2 动态生成PDF
- 使用服务器端脚本(如PHP、Python)根据用户选择的语言动态生成PDF,减少存储空间占用。
- 示例(伪代码):
from reportlab.pdfgen import canvas def generate_pdf(language): text = get_translated_text(language) # 从数据库或JSON加载翻译 c = canvas.Canvas(f"manual_{language}.pdf") c.drawString(100, 800, text["title"]) c.save()
5.3 CDN加速下载分发网络(CDN)存储PDF文件,加快全球用户的下载速度,降低服务器负载。
6 用户友好的下载界面
- 在官网或产品支持页面提供清晰的语言选择器(如国旗图标或下拉菜单)。
- 示例HTML代码:
<select id="language-selector"> <option value="en">English</option> <option value="zh">中文</option> <option value="fr">Français</option> </select> <button onclick="downloadManual()">Download Manual</button> <script> function downloadManual() { const lang = document.getElementById("language-selector").value; window.location.href = `/manuals/user_manual_${lang}.pdf`; } </script>
最佳实践与未来趋势
1 持续集成与自动化测试
- 将文档生成与产品开发流程集成,确保每次产品更新时自动触发多语言文档构建。
- 使用自动化测试工具(如Selenium)检查PDF的格式和链接有效性。
2 增强现实(AR)与交互式文档
未来趋势可能包括:
- AR技术提供多语言指导(如扫描产品二维码弹出对应语言的3D操作指南)。
- 交互式PDF(嵌入视频、可点击目录)。
3 AI驱动的智能文档管理
- 利用AI自动检测文档更新需求并触发翻译流程。
- NLP技术优化多语言搜索功能,帮助用户快速找到所需信息。
提供多语言PDF下载是电子类产品技术文档管理的关键环节,通过结构化写作、专业翻译、自动化生成和智能分发策略,企业可以高效管理多语言文档,提升全球用户体验,随着AI和AR技术的发展,技术文档的呈现方式将更加智能化、交互化,但PDF仍将是重要的分发格式之一,企业应持续优化文档管理流程,以满足不断变化的全球市场需求。